		<description>I tried this product for the first time last Saturday evening, 11/7/09, and it seemed to work pretty well. Followed directions carefully with the 4X retinol night cream and the Hyaluronic day cream. Things went well until Wednesday when the area where I had applied the patches started burning when I put on the cream, and by Thursday morning I noriced I had very red skin in the exact shape of the patches under both eyes, and puting anything on it causes severe burning sensation, even my regular make up. My eyes are also much puffier than before use and the wrinkles do look a little worse. If this is a lasting effect I totally intend to contact a lawyer.

Do not use this product, it is not worth it!!!</description>

		<description>I am writing this on behalf of my mom...as a warning to all you ladies out there.  My mom just turned 47 and is finishing her MBA and thought...why not just try to get these wrinkles under wraps. So she bought the WrinkleFree Eyes system by University Medical thinking it would be an inexpensive way to just tighten the skin around her eyes, just the typical crows feet and under the eye.  Well...after careful preparation and strictly following instructions to the application she put on the eye patch and waited 20 minutes.  She didn&#039;t notice a big difference right away but she put on the night cream and went to bed. And guess what happened next!! First thing in the morning we looked to see the results and saw a red flakey patch of burning residue from the patch! it looked like she still had it on!! she used the morning cream once thinking it would calm it down and work...but it only added about three more wrinkles that are parallel to her nose...not even normal wrinkle lines!... than were origionally there plus the red patch under her eyes.  So warning to the wise...be careful with this one. If you feel burning or itching...STOP IMMEDIATELY!!</description>
